Output 768e608f4bd6dc136ed10ffbcd32058eaeb0c8abc5e14539f039100955dbcefc:8

value
30000000
script pubkey
OP_0 OP_PUSHBYTES_20 ef0f887fc7c0f7e31e64b911f0ce07f1d7c3ee38
address
bc1qau8csl78crm7x8nyhyglpns878tu8m3c2hezpa
transaction
768e608f4bd6dc136ed10ffbcd32058eaeb0c8abc5e14539f039100955dbcefc
confirmations
233073
spent
true